package server_test
import (
"net/http"
"testing"
"gitea.meghsakha.com/platform/tenant-registry/internal/store"
)
func TestCreateAPIKey_then_verify(t *testing.T) {
eachStore(t, func(t *testing.T, h *testHarness) {
resp, body := h.do("POST", "/v1/api-keys", map[string]any{
"tenant_id": h.tenant.ID, "name": "ci-bot", "product": "certifai",
"scopes": []string{"certifai:read", "certifai:write"},
})
if resp.StatusCode != http.StatusCreated {
t.Fatalf("create status = %d, body=%s", resp.StatusCode, body)
}
created := decode[struct {
APIKey store.APIKey `json:"api_key"`
Plaintext string `json:"plaintext"`
}](t, body)
if len(created.Plaintext) < 30 || created.Plaintext[:3] != "bp_" {
t.Fatalf("bad plaintext: %q", created.Plaintext)
}
if len(created.APIKey.Scopes) != 2 || created.APIKey.Product != "certifai" {
t.Errorf("unexpected key: %+v", created.APIKey)
}
// Verify with the plaintext key.
resp, body = h.do("POST", "/v1/internal/api-keys/verify", map[string]any{
"key": created.Plaintext,
})
if resp.StatusCode != 200 {
t.Fatalf("verify status = %d, body=%s", resp.StatusCode, body)
}
v := decode[struct {
Valid bool `json:"valid"`
TenantID string `json:"tenant_id"`
Product string `json:"product"`
Scopes []string `json:"scopes"`
}](t, body)
if !v.Valid || v.TenantID != h.tenant.ID || v.Product != "certifai" || len(v.Scopes) != 2 {
t.Errorf("verify returned %+v", v)
}
// Revoke; verify now returns valid=false.
resp, _ = h.do("DELETE", "/v1/api-keys/"+created.APIKey.ID, nil)
if resp.StatusCode != http.StatusNoContent {
t.Fatalf("revoke status = %d", resp.StatusCode)
}
resp, body = h.do("POST", "/v1/internal/api-keys/verify", map[string]any{"key": created.Plaintext})
if resp.StatusCode != 200 {
t.Fatalf("verify-after-revoke status = %d", resp.StatusCode)
}
v = decode[struct {
Valid bool `json:"valid"`
TenantID string `json:"tenant_id"`
Product string `json:"product"`
Scopes []string `json:"scopes"`
}](t, body)
if v.Valid {
t.Error("revoked key still verifies")
}
})
}
func TestVerifyAPIKey_garbage(t *testing.T) {
eachStore(t, func(t *testing.T, h *testHarness) {
for _, key := range []string{"", "not-a-key", "bp_short", "ax_wrongprefix1234567"} {
resp, body := h.do("POST", "/v1/internal/api-keys/verify", map[string]any{"key": key})
if resp.StatusCode != 200 {
t.Fatalf("status = %d for key %q", resp.StatusCode, key)
}
v := decode[struct {
Valid bool `json:"valid"`
}](t, body)
if v.Valid {
t.Errorf("garbage key %q verified as valid", key)
}
}
})
}
func TestCreateAPIKey_unknownProduct(t *testing.T) {
eachStore(t, func(t *testing.T, h *testHarness) {
resp, _ := h.do("POST", "/v1/api-keys", map[string]any{
"tenant_id": h.tenant.ID, "name": "k", "product": "bogus",
})
if resp.StatusCode != http.StatusBadRequest {
t.Fatalf("status = %d", resp.StatusCode)
}
})
}
func TestListAPIKeys(t *testing.T) {
eachStore(t, func(t *testing.T, h *testHarness) {
respA, bodyA := h.do("POST", "/v1/api-keys", map[string]any{
"tenant_id": h.tenant.ID, "name": "alpha",
})
if respA.StatusCode != http.StatusCreated {
t.Fatalf("alpha create: status=%d body=%s", respA.StatusCode, bodyA)
}
respB, bodyB := h.do("POST", "/v1/api-keys", map[string]any{
"tenant_id": h.tenant.ID, "name": "beta",
})
if respB.StatusCode != http.StatusCreated {
t.Fatalf("beta create: status=%d body=%s", respB.StatusCode, bodyB)
}
resp, body := h.do("GET", "/v1/api-keys?tenant_id="+h.tenant.ID, nil)
if resp.StatusCode != 200 {
t.Fatalf("status = %d", resp.StatusCode)
}
out := decode[struct {
Items []store.APIKey `json:"items"`
}](t, body)
if len(out.Items) < 2 {
t.Errorf("expected ≥2 keys, got %d", len(out.Items))
}
// Plaintext / hash must NOT leak in the list response.
for _, k := range out.Items {
rawJSON, _ := h.do("GET", "/v1/api-keys?tenant_id="+h.tenant.ID, nil)
_ = rawJSON
if k.Prefix == "" {
t.Error("prefix missing")
}
}
})
}
